Understanding Managed Cloud Services
Managed cloud services are a set of solutions designed to manage a business’s cloud environment. This includes everything from infrastructure management to security protocols, ensuring that cloud operations run smoothly and efficiently. These services are especially beneficial for businesses that lack the technical expertise or resources to handle cloud infrastructure independently.
Benefits of Managed Cloud Services
- Scalability: Managed cloud services provide the flexibility to scale resources up or down based on demand, which is critical for businesses with fluctuating workloads.
- Cost Efficiency: By outsourcing cloud management, businesses can reduce the overhead costs associated with maintaining in-house IT staff.
- Expert Support: Access to a team of cloud experts ensures that any technical issues are addressed promptly, minimizing downtime.
- Enhanced Security: Providers offer secure cloud storage solutions and implement stringent security measures to protect sensitive business data.
Key Considerations When Choosing a Provider
When selecting a managed cloud services provider, it’s essential to consider several factors to ensure a good fit for your business needs.
Service Offerings
- Evaluate the range of services provided, including data management, security, compliance, and backup solutions.
- Ensure the provider offers cloud solutions for business that align with your specific industry requirements.
Security and Compliance
- Check the provider’s security protocols and compliance certifications to ensure they meet industry standards.
- Verify their ability to handle sensitive data securely, especially if your business operates in a highly regulated industry.
Scalability and Flexibility
- Assess the provider’s capability to scale services according to your business growth and changing needs.
- Look for customizable solutions that can adapt to your evolving operational demands.
Cost and Pricing Models
- Review the provider’s pricing structure to understand the total cost of ownership.
- Consider whether the pricing model aligns with your budget and offers value for money.
